General guidance for planning a rental like this — from the Localis editorial team, not specific to any one company.
As a rough guide, allow about 8 sq ft per guest for rows of seating, 10–12 for banquet tables, and more once you add a dance floor, bar, or buffet. Share your headcount and plan so the vendor can size it correctly.
Tents are staked into grass or weighted on hard surfaces. Larger frame and pole tents may require permits or utility line marking, so confirm the install method for your specific site.
Big tents often go up the day before an event. Ask about the delivery and takedown window so it lines up with your venue access and other vendors.
Concession and warming equipment can draw significant power — confirm the circuit or generator can handle it, and match machine output to your guest count.
Linen size depends on the table’s shape and the drop you want (lap-length vs. floor-length). Confirm your table dimensions before choosing so the linens hang correctly.
Designer and specialty inventory is limited and books up fast for peak weekends. Reserve well ahead and confirm delivery, styling, and setup details.

For popular dates — spring and summer weekends, holidays, and graduation season — booking a few weeks to a couple of months ahead is wise, since inventory is limited. Last-minute rentals are sometimes possible but limit your selection.
Tent size depends on guest count and layout: roughly 8 sq ft per person for rows of seating and 10–12 for banquet tables, plus extra for a dance floor, bar, or buffet. Give the vendor your headcount and plan so they can size it correctly.
Reputable operators monitor conditions and will pause, reschedule, or take down equipment in high wind or storms for safety. Ask about the weather, deposit, and cancellation policy in writing before you pay so there are no surprises.
Many party rental companies take a deposit to hold your date, with the balance due before or on delivery. Deposit amounts and refund terms vary by company — confirm them up front as part of your booking.
